Wholesale Green Ceramic Planters for Biophilic Design Projects

 

Biophilic design relies on materials that connect built environments with natural elements in a way that feels intentional, scalable, and visually cohesive. Wholesale green ceramic planters are widely used in these projects because they allow designers to maintain consistency across large spaces while still introducing variation in form, texture, and scale.

The following list highlights different green ceramic planter styles commonly specified in biophilic design projects. Each one serves a distinct spatial role, helping you choose the right balance of structure, softness, and rhythm across commercial, hospitality, and landscape applications.

Diamond Relief Tall Planter

A strong vertical form used when a space needs clear structure and height definition without introducing visual heaviness. The diamond relief surface adds subtle texture that gently interacts with light, giving it a refined architectural presence within planting schemes.

In large-scale biophilic layouts, it works best as a framing element. It is commonly positioned at entry points, landscape corners, or pathway transitions where vertical repetition helps guide movement and establish spatial order. Upright plants such as small trees or structural shrubs work especially well with it, reinforcing its elongated form and helping maintain overall compositional balance.

Dimpled Jar Planter

Often chosen for its softer visual language, this planter introduces rounded form and tactile surface variation into more structured environments. The dimpled texture creates depth without overwhelming surrounding greenery, making it useful where subtle detail is preferred over bold geometry.

It performs well in transitional landscape zones where planting needs to feel natural and integrated. Courtyards, entry gardens, and indoor-outdoor thresholds benefit from its balanced proportions. Mid-height foliage and flowering plants help emphasize its organic character while maintaining visual calm within the overall layout.

Fluted Marble Green Planter

A visually active form defined by vertical fluting and a marble-inspired green finish that enhances surface movement. This combination creates rhythm and direction, making it suitable for layouts that rely on repetition and structured flow.

It is frequently used in linear applications such as storefront edges, garden bed borders, and patio runs. The vertical grooves naturally complement upright planting styles, reinforcing height and helping create continuity across repeated placements in commercial biophilic projects.

Elegant Pedestal Pot

This planter introduces elevation as its defining feature, lifting planting compositions above ground level to create a more intentional visual focus. The pedestal base adds formality while also improving visibility in dense planting arrangements.

It is best suited for focal placements rather than background distribution. Entry courtyards, central landscape nodes, and feature groupings benefit from its raised profile. Lush or fuller plant types enhance its presence, allowing it to function as a visual anchor within layered biophilic systems.

Tall Column Planter

A strong structural form designed around vertical repetition and spatial rhythm. Its segmented cylindrical shape creates a steady architectural cadence that works well in large, open environments requiring visual order.

It is commonly used to define circulation routes, frame entrances, or mark transitions between outdoor zones. Ornamental grasses and compact shrubs complement its upright structure, reinforcing directional flow and supporting consistent spatial layering across wide landscapes.

Fluted Cylinder Planter Set

This set is designed for repetition, making it especially effective in biophilic projects where consistency across multiple placements is essential. The cylindrical shape combined with fluted detailing introduces controlled texture and vertical emphasis.

It is typically deployed in grouped or linear arrangements such as walkways, retail corridors, or courtyard edges. The repeated form helps establish rhythm across space, while the fluting supports plants with upright growth patterns, strengthening visual continuity across the installation.

Ribbed Rectangle Planters

A more structured and directional form that introduces clear spatial boundaries within planting layouts. The rectangular geometry provides order, while ribbed detailing adds subtle surface variation without distracting from plant material.

These planters are often used to organize space rather than act as focal points. They work well for defining walkways, structuring retail layouts, or segmenting courtyard planting grids, with their elongated form supporting balanced planting distribution across commercial environments where clarity and separation are important.

Vintage Tuscany Vert Bulb Pot

A softer, more traditional silhouette that introduces rounded volume into structured biophilic environments; the bulb form combined with a pedestal base creates layered proportions, adding depth and visual contrast within modern architectural settings.

It is frequently used as a stabilizing feature within mixed-height planting compositions. Entry zones, courtyard centers, and decorative focal areas benefit from its fuller shape, especially when paired with flowering plants or dense foliage that enhances its organic presence.

Rimmed Round Planter Set

A foundational planter style used for flexibility and repetition across large-scale projects. The simple round form with subtle rim detailing makes it highly adaptable to different planting styles and spatial configurations.

It is best used as a modular component rather than a focal element. These planters can be distributed across multiple zones to create rhythm, grouped for density, or used in retail merchandising layouts where adaptability and consistency are key requirements.

Grooved Square Planter

A balanced geometric form that combines structured edges with soft surface detailing. The grooved texture introduces subtle movement across the surface while maintaining a clean, architectural silhouette.

It works well in organized landscape settings such as entry courtyards, seating zones, or commercial gathering spaces. When grouped, it helps define spatial boundaries while still allowing greenery to remain the primary visual focus, supporting both structure and softness within biophilic compositions.


Creating Cohesive Biophilic Spaces with Wholesale Green Ceramic Planters

Wholesale green ceramic planters are key elements in building cohesive biophilic design projects that feel connected, functional, and visually balanced at scale. Across different forms, textures, and proportions, they translate natural planting concepts into structured environments while maintaining flexibility and design intent.

Their value comes from how they function together as a system—supporting spatial definition, guiding movement, softening architectural edges, and establishing rhythm across large commercial or landscape settings. When selected thoughtfully, each planter contributes to a unified design language rather than acting as an isolated object.

Successful biophilic projects rely on a balance of consistency and variation. Green ceramic planters make this achievable by combining durability, repeatability, and design adaptability within a single, cohesive material approach.
